A research-focused master's in polymer materials engineering emphasizing applied and translational work in polymers, composites and functional coatings. Suited to graduates seeking hands‑on laboratory research, industry collaboration and thesis work that bridge materials science with medical, aerospace, textile and environmental applications.

Graduates gain skills applicable to R&D roles across polymers and composites, including positions in medical materials, aerospace and lightweight structures, textiles and wearable technology, packaging and biodegradable materials, coatings and adhesives, additive manufacturing (3D printing) and defence‑related materials engineering. The department’s record of publications and conference presentations suggests strong preparation for research careers or continuation to doctoral study.
Research within the department is frequently supported by external grants and industry funding. During 2020–2021 many projects were financed by industry, the Ministry of Defense’s Administration for the Development of Weapons and Technological Infrastructure, the Israel Innovation Authority, the Ministry of Science and Technology and EU research funds; master’s students commonly participate in funded projects as part of their internship and thesis research.
